Serebrovasküler Olay ve Geçici İskemik Atak
Synopsis
Serebrovasküler olaylar (SVO) ve geçici iskemik ataklar (GİA), bir an önce tanısının konması ve tedavisine başlanması gereken nörolojik acillerdir. Serebrovasküler olayları, iskemik ve hemorajik inme olarak genel hatlarıyla ikiye ayırabiliriz. İnmenin etiyolojisinin belirlenmesi, hem prognozu hem de sonuçları doğrudan etkilediği için önemlidir (1,2). İskemik inme, beyne giden kan akışında azalmaya neden olan trombotik veya embolik bir olaydan kaynaklanmaktadır. Hemorajik inme, beyin dokusunu besleyen bir damardan kaynaklanan kanama sonucunda ortaya çıkar. Hemorajik inme ayrıca intraserebral kanama (İSK) ve subaraknoid kanama (SAK) olarak alt bölümlere ayrılabilir. Hemorajik inme ciddi morbidite ve yüksek mortalite ile ilişkilidir (3). GİA ise, herhangi bir akut enfarkt ya da doku hasarı meydana gelmeksizin fokal serebral, spinal kord ya da retinal iskemiden kaynaklan geçici nörolojik işlev bozukluğu olarak tanımlanır, tipik olarak bir saatten az sürer, daha sıklıkla dakikalar sürer. GİA, yaklaşan bir iskemik inme için ciddi bir uyarı olarak kabul edilebilir. Geçici iskemik ataklar genellikle altta yatan serebrovasküler hastalığa bağlı olarak fokal nörolojik defisit ile ilişkilidir ve her zaman ani başlangıçlıdır.
